Features Inverter-based digital wave control GMAW and FCAW welding outfit. Higher efficiency and higher power factor results in greater power saving. Designed to work even under high ambient temperatures up to 500C. Light weight and compact MIG/MAG/FCAW we

TECHNICAL DATA:
POWRE SOURCE
INPUT SUPPLY Voltage (V) : 415, +15%, -20%
Phase/Freq (No./Hz): 3ph/50-60
Max, input KVA @ 415Vac –
@ 60% duty cycle (KVA/KW) : 16.2/15.6
@ 100% duty cycle (KVA/KW): –
OUTPUT –
Rated Current Range(Amps): 50-400
Rated output range (V): 16.5-35.5
Welding current (400C)
@60% Duty cycle (Amps) : 400
@100% Duty Cycle (Amps): 310
General –
Power control method: IGBT inverter controlled
Digital display: 4 digit 7 segment LED Display
Wave from control: Digitally controlled wave form
Welding sequence
a. Main welding
b. Main welding crater (crater repeat is available)
c. Main welding crater (crater repeat is available)
Ingress protection (Class): IP 23S
Insulation (Type): H
Cooling: Forced air cooling
Power Factor (Degree C): >0.9
Operating Temperature: -10 to 50
Dimension (L X B X H): 545 x 380 x570
Weight (KG): 52
Wire feeder
Rated welding current (amps): 400
Applicable wire diameter: 0.8, 1.0, 1.2
Cable length: 1.8m(gas hose 4.8m)
Weight: 10.5
Wire feed speed : 5.3-20.1
Duty cycle: 60
Welding torch : 400
Duty cycle (10 min cycle): 400 Amps, 60% (CO2) 360 Amps, 60% (CO2+Ar)
Duty cycle (continuous): 310 Amps, 100%(CO2) 280 Amps, 100% (CO2+Ar)
Applicable wire diameter(mm) : 08., 1.0, 1.2
Cable length(meter): 3
Weight (incl. cable)(KG): 2.8
